Loading...
3

Used 2017 Subaru Impreza for Sale in Buffalo, NY

2017 Subaru Impreza Premium
2017 Subaru Impreza Premium
2017 Subaru Impreza Premium
2017 Subaru Impreza Premium
2017 Subaru Impreza Premium
2017 Subaru Impreza Premium
Used·45,916 mi

$16,546

2017 Subaru Impreza Sport
2017 Subaru Impreza Sport
2017 Subaru Impreza Sport
Stock image
;